이 집합의 용어 (15)
하이드의 정의
What does the debt to assets ratio help us analyze about a company?
It helps us analyze how a company's assets are financed, specifically the proportion financed by liabilities.
What is the formula for the debt to assets ratio?
The formula is total liabilities divided by total assets.
What does a higher debt to assets ratio indicate about a company's financial obligations?
A higher ratio indicates higher financial obligations related to debt repayments, increasing the risk of default.
What does a lower debt to assets ratio suggest about investment safety?
A lower debt ratio suggests a safer investment because it implies fewer liabilities and lower financial risk.
If a company has a debt to assets ratio of 0.3, what does this mean?
It means that 30% of the semi company's assets are financed by debt.
Why is equity considered less risky than debt in financing assets?
Equity is less risky because dividend payments are not mandatory, unlike debt payments which must be made.
What happens if a company fails to make required debt payments?
If a company fails to make debt payments, it risks defaulting on its loans and facing additional financial penalties.
How does the debt to assets ratio relate to the accounting equation?
It focuses on the liabilities portion of the equation: assets = liabilities + equity.
What type of ratio is the debt to assets ratio classified as?
It is classified as a solvency ratio.
What does the debt to assets ratio tell us in percentage terms?
It tells us the percentage of a company's assets that are financed through debt.
Why might investors prefer companies with lower debt to assets ratios?
Investors may prefer lower ratios because they indicate lower financial risk and fewer mandatory debt payments.
What is the main risk associated with a high debt to assets ratio?
The main risk is increased likelihood of default due to higher required debt repayments.
How does the debt to assets ratio help in understanding a company's financial structure?
It shows how much of the company's assets are funded by debt versus equity.
What is the impact of having low liabilities on a company's risk profile?
Low liabilities mean lower debt payments and reduced financial risk.
Is paying dividends on equity mandatory like paying interest on debt?
No, paying dividends is not mandatory, but paying interest on debt is required.
